20 Best Dress Shoes for Women

Let’s throw out an old myth: Stylish, dressy shoes do not need to be uncomfortable. Sure, we might all rather be lounging in a pair of fluffy slippers at any given moment, but certain occasions like an office setting or a wedding call for more sophisticated attire. Still, there are plenty of dress shoes for women on the market that won’t force you to lug around your back-up sneakers or rely on the complimentary flip flops at a wedding reception.

Whether you’re looking for pain-free pumps, the best loafers to pair with a suit or the best flats for spring, we’ve rounded up the very best dressy footwear in every category — all with comfort in mind.
